Welcome to the America's Boating Club® Southeastern New England, District 34 Website. America's Boating Club is the world's largest private and fraternal membership organization dedicated to the education of sail and power boaters. District 34 includes cities and towns in Greater Boston, North to Cape Ann, West to Worcester, South to Rhode Island, and Cape Cod. District 34 provides many maritime-oriented educational programs for members and the general boating public. |

New Governing Board Emeritus and Life MembersHere are the newest Life and Governing Board Emeritus Members in America's Boating Club - Southeastern New England. Each Governing Board Emeritus member earned 50 Merit Marks and each Life member earned 25 Merit Marks for meritorious service given unstintingly and unselfishly in the interests of our organization.
